Output 8c8b03862dc685ed1025089d13c575a6b6989e9fbf4298c943fba8300bd3a1d7:7

value
663971695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d5a1ee21aaf4a38eb9380c724ed29bd8eaab5df OP_EQUAL
address
32ucfjFMoWYKPWZYWqAykuNSBgFNXeEZcL
transaction
8c8b03862dc685ed1025089d13c575a6b6989e9fbf4298c943fba8300bd3a1d7
spent
true